Guayusa Tea

Guayusa is a caffeinated tea from the Amazon (related to yerba mate) that contains about 66mg of caffeine per cup — similar to green tea. In moderation, it's likely fine while breastfeeding, but it hasn't been specifically studied in nursing mothers. Count it toward your daily caffeine limit of 300mg and monitor your baby for any sensitivity.
